Interoperabilidad de WPS para Python

Módulos de lenguaje SAS

Usa el lenguaje SAS y Python conjuntamente

El módulo WPS Interop for Python admite el uso del lenguaje Python en los programas SAS. El entorno de Python procesará automáticamente las secciones del programa escrito en Python, junto con los datos.

Motivo de la interoperación

La combinación de los lenguajes Python y SAS crea una solución unificada. Mezcla el tratamiento de datos de elevado rendimiento y las fortalezas del análisis industrial del lenguaje SAS, con tu sintaxis y bibliotecas favoritas de Python. Los datos se intercambian y procesan fácilmente entre el lenguaje Python y SAS dentro de un único programa SAS.

Procedimiento Python

El procedimiento permite insertar o incluir la sintaxis de Python directamente en un programa SAS. Cuando se ejecuta el programa SAS, WPS procesa la sintaxis del lenguaje SAS y utiliza el entorno de Python instalado para la ejecución de la sintaxis de Python.

La salida y la información de registro, generadas por el entorno de Python, vuelven automáticamente a WPS y se pueden visualizar perfectamente con la GUI WPS Workbench.

PROC PYTHON también proporciona una forma sencilla y eficiente de intercambiar datos entre los entornos de lenguaje SAS y Python utilizando Pandas DataFrames.

Dependencias y uso

WPS Interop for Python se puede utilizar en las plataformas admitidas que se indican en la tabla a continuación.

Plataforma ¿Compatible?
AIX en IBM Power
Linux en ARM
Linux en IBM Power LE (Little Endian)
Linux en x86
macOS en x86
Windows en x86
z/OS en una máquina con arquitectura 7

Más información

El documento mencionado a continuación proporciona la información acerca de como instalar y utilizar WPS Interop for Python.

Procedimiento Python Descripción
WPS-Python-Procedure-User-Guide-Syntax-Diagram.pdf (150 KB) Guía del usuario y búsqueda del soporte para el lenguaje en el módulo WPS Interop for Python (versión DIAGRAMA DE SINTAXIS)

 

Otros módulos de lenguaje SAS

Básico de WPS

Soporte para el lenguaje principal, macros, salida y formatos de archivo de datos estándar (conjuntos de datos, archivos secuenciales, archivos de transporte)

Creación de gráficos de WPS

Soporte para el lenguaje para la creación de gráficos y diagramas

Estadísticas de WPS

Soporte para el lenguaje para el análisis estadístico

Serie temporal de WPS

Soporte para el lenguaje para el análisis de serie temporal

Programación de matriz de WPS

Sintaxis del lenguaje para la manipulación avanzada de matriz

Aprendizaje automático de WPS

Soporte para el lenguaje para algoritmos de aprendizaje automático

Interoperabilidad de WPS para R

Soporte para el lenguaje de R

Interoperabilidad de WPS para Python

Soporte para el lenguaje de Python

Interoperabilidad de WPS para Hadoop

Soporte para el lenguaje para interactuar con entornos de Big Data para Hadoop

WPS Communicate

Ejecuta mediante programación partes de un script en instalaciones de WPS ubicadas en servidores remotos y carga o descarga datos en/desde servidores remotos

SDK para lenguajes de WPS

Desarrolla tus elementos personalizados del lenguaje SAS

¿Tienes alguna pregunta?

Ponte en contacto con nuestro equipo de ventas

Probar o comprar

Edición Estándar
Edición Académica
Edición de Comunidad